Internet and messaging settings

To access the Internet and to send multimedia messages, you must have a mobile
data connection and the correct settings, also known as APN (Access Point Name)
settings. The APN identifies the network that a mobile device can connect to.
If you cannot access the Internet, have no data connection, or cannot send or receive
multimedia messages, try deleting all Internet and messaging settings, and then add them
again.
To add Internet settings manually
From the Home screen, tap
1
Find and tap Settings > More... > Mobile networks > Access Point Names.
2
Tap .
3
Tap New APN.
4
Tap Name and enter the name of the network profile that you want to create.
5
Tap APN and enter the access point name.
6
Enter all other information required by your network operator.
7
Tap , then tap Save.
8
